Understanding the Root Causes of a Unstable Christmas Tree

Before you start wrestling with your tree and stand, it’s helpful to understand why trees tip over in the first place. Several factors can contribute to this frustrating situation, and identifying the culprit is the first step towards a stable solution.

The Ill-Fitting Stand: A Common Culprit

One of the most frequent reasons for a tree’s instability is simply an improperly sized or inadequate tree stand. Stands come in various sizes and weight capacities, and using one that’s too small for your tree is a recipe for disaster.

Consider the tree’s height and trunk diameter. A taller tree needs a wider base of support, and a thicker trunk requires a larger opening in the stand. Always check the manufacturer’s specifications for the stand’s maximum tree height and trunk diameter to ensure it’s a suitable match.

Examine the stand’s construction. Is it made of sturdy metal or flimsy plastic? A well-constructed stand is essential for providing adequate support, especially for larger trees. Cheap, lightweight stands are often insufficient and prone to bending or breaking under the tree’s weight.

Evaluate the stand’s water reservoir. A larger water reservoir not only keeps your tree hydrated longer but also adds weight to the base, improving stability. A stand with a small water capacity might need frequent refills and offer less overall support.

The Crooked Trunk: Nature’s Curveball

Even with the right stand, a crooked or uneven tree trunk can make it difficult to achieve a stable setup. Trees don’t always grow perfectly straight, and a significant curve in the trunk can throw off the balance.

Inspect the trunk before buying. When selecting your tree, take a close look at the trunk. Avoid trees with severe bends or knots near the base. A slight curve might be manageable, but anything too pronounced will make it challenging to center the tree in the stand.

Consider trimming the base. If the trunk is only slightly crooked at the very bottom, you might be able to trim it to create a flat, even surface. However, be cautious not to remove too much, as this can reduce the trunk’s diameter and make it more difficult to secure in the stand.

Use shims to correct minor imbalances. If you can’t trim the trunk, you can use shims (small pieces of wood or plastic) to fill the gaps between the trunk and the stand’s clamps. This can help to level the tree and prevent it from leaning.

Improper Tightening: A Crucial Step Often Overlooked

Even if you have a properly sized stand and a relatively straight trunk, failing to tighten the stand’s bolts or clamps correctly can lead to instability. These mechanisms are designed to hold the tree securely in place, and if they’re not tightened enough, the tree will wobble.

Tighten bolts evenly. Most tree stands use three or four bolts to secure the tree. When tightening them, do so evenly, working your way around the trunk in a circular pattern. Avoid tightening one bolt completely before moving on to the others, as this can cause the tree to lean to one side.

Don’t overtighten. While it’s important to tighten the bolts securely, be careful not to overtighten them. Overtightening can damage the tree trunk or strip the threads on the bolts, making them less effective. Tighten until the tree feels stable but not to the point where you’re straining the bolts.

Check for slippage. After initially tightening the bolts, give the tree a gentle shake to see if it moves. If it does, tighten the bolts a little more. You may need to repeat this process several times until the tree is completely secure.

Tree Weight and Height: The Physics of Stability

The sheer weight and height of the tree play a significant role in its stability. A taller, heavier tree will naturally be more prone to tipping than a smaller, lighter one.

Choose the right size tree for your space. Don’t try to squeeze a towering tree into a room with low ceilings. Not only will it look out of place, but it will also be more likely to tip over. Consider the height of your ceiling and choose a tree that leaves ample headroom.

Consider the weight distribution. A tree with a dense, heavy top can be more prone to tipping than one with a more balanced weight distribution. When selecting your tree, look for one that has a relatively even shape and doesn’t appear too top-heavy.

Use a larger stand for taller trees. As mentioned earlier, a taller tree requires a wider base of support. If you’re planning on getting a tall tree, invest in a larger, more robust stand that can handle the extra weight.

Practical Solutions to Stabilize Your Christmas Tree

Now that we’ve covered the common causes of an unstable Christmas tree, let’s move on to some practical solutions. These tips and tricks will help you secure your tree and enjoy a worry-free holiday season.

Choosing the Right Tree Stand: A Worthwhile Investment

Selecting the correct tree stand is the most crucial step in ensuring your tree’s stability. Don’t skimp on this purchase; investing in a high-quality stand will save you headaches in the long run.

Measure your tree’s trunk diameter. Before buying a stand, measure the diameter of your tree’s trunk at the base. This will help you choose a stand with an opening that’s large enough to accommodate the trunk.

Consider the tree’s height and weight. As mentioned earlier, the stand’s specifications should clearly state its maximum tree height and weight capacity. Choose a stand that can comfortably handle your tree’s size and weight.

Look for a stand with a wide base. A wider base provides more stability and reduces the risk of tipping. Look for stands with a base diameter that’s at least half the height of the tree.

Opt for a stand with a large water reservoir. A larger water reservoir not only keeps your tree hydrated but also adds weight to the base, improving stability.

Consider a stand with a foot pedal. Some stands feature a foot pedal that allows you to tighten the clamps hands-free. This can be a convenient feature, especially when you’re setting up the tree by yourself.

Preparing the Tree Trunk: A Foundation for Stability

Properly preparing the tree trunk is essential for creating a solid connection between the tree and the stand.

Cut the trunk straight. If the tree trunk is uneven or angled, cut it straight using a saw. This will create a flat surface that sits evenly in the stand.

Remove any lower branches. Remove any branches that are too low and will interfere with the stand. This will also make it easier to access the trunk for tightening the bolts.

Make a fresh cut. Even if the tree has already been cut, it’s a good idea to make a fresh cut at the base. This will help the tree absorb water more effectively.

Securing the Tree in the Stand: The Tightening Process

Properly tightening the stand’s bolts or clamps is crucial for keeping the tree upright.

Center the tree in the stand. Carefully center the tree in the stand, making sure the trunk is positioned evenly within the opening.

Tighten the bolts evenly. As mentioned earlier, tighten the bolts evenly, working your way around the trunk in a circular pattern.

Use shims if necessary. If there are gaps between the trunk and the clamps, use shims to fill them in. This will help to stabilize the tree and prevent it from leaning.

Check for stability. After tightening the bolts, give the tree a gentle shake to see if it moves. If it does, tighten the bolts a little more.

Additional Stabilization Techniques: Going the Extra Mile

If you’re still concerned about your tree’s stability, there are a few additional techniques you can use to provide extra support.

Use guy wires. Attach guy wires to the tree’s upper branches and anchor them to the walls or ceiling. This will provide additional support and prevent the tree from tipping over.

Add weight to the base. Place heavy objects around the base of the stand, such as sandbags or bricks. This will add extra weight and improve stability.

Consider a tree stand mat. A tree stand mat can help to protect your floors from scratches and spills. It can also provide a slightly more stable surface for the stand.

Maintaining Stability Throughout the Season

Once your tree is securely in place, it’s important to maintain its stability throughout the holiday season.

Regular Watering: A Key to Longevity and Stability

Keep the tree stand’s water reservoir filled at all times. A well-hydrated tree will be heavier and more stable than a dry one.

Monitoring for Leaning: Early Detection is Key

Periodically check the tree to make sure it’s not leaning. If you notice any leaning, tighten the bolts or add more shims as needed.

Adjusting Ornaments: Distribute the Weight Evenly

Distribute ornaments evenly around the tree to prevent it from becoming top-heavy. Avoid placing too many heavy ornaments on one side of the tree.

Why does my Christmas tree keep leaning or falling over in the stand?

Several factors can contribute to a Christmas tree refusing to stay upright. Primarily, the most common issue is an improperly sized tree stand. If the stand’s diameter is too small for the tree’s trunk or the stand isn’t designed to support the tree’s height and weight, it will inevitably become unstable. Another common culprit is an uneven base on the tree itself, causing it to wobble and making it difficult for the stand’s screws to grip evenly.

Furthermore, the tree stand’s tightening mechanisms may be faulty or not properly engaged. Over time, plastic or metal screws can wear down, making it impossible to secure the tree effectively. In other cases, people may not be tightening the screws equally around the trunk, creating an imbalance that leads to leaning or tipping. Always inspect the stand for damage and ensure all screws are in good working order and tightened evenly.

What size Christmas tree stand do I need for my tree?

Choosing the right size tree stand is crucial for stability. Tree stand manufacturers typically specify the maximum tree height and trunk diameter that the stand can accommodate. Be sure to measure both the height of your tree (from the base of the trunk to the tip) and the diameter of the trunk at the cut end. A stand that’s too small simply won’t provide adequate support, regardless of how tightly you screw it.

As a general guideline, consider that larger trees, especially those taller than 8 feet, will require a larger and heavier stand. Look for stands designed for “extra large” trees, and always err on the side of caution. It’s better to have a stand that’s slightly too large than one that’s too small. A wider base and a larger water reservoir will also contribute to greater stability and keep your tree hydrated longer.

How do I prepare the base of my Christmas tree before putting it in the stand?

Preparing the tree base is an essential step often overlooked. Start by making a fresh, clean cut across the base of the trunk, removing about an inch or two of wood. This removes any sap that has sealed the pores, allowing the tree to absorb water more effectively. Ensure the cut is perpendicular to the trunk to create a flat surface for even contact with the stand.

Next, check for any loose or broken branches near the base of the tree that might interfere with the stand’s mechanism or prevent a flush fit. You can carefully trim these branches if necessary, being mindful not to remove too much and compromise the tree’s overall shape. Remove any bark or debris from the base that might prevent the screws from gripping properly. A clean and flat base will greatly improve the tree’s stability in the stand.

What if my Christmas tree trunk is too big for my stand?

If the trunk of your Christmas tree is too large for your stand, forcing it will likely damage the stand or prevent the screws from gripping properly, leading to an unstable setup. Avoid trying to jam the tree into the stand at all costs. This could not only cause the tree to fall but also potentially damage your floors or injure someone.

The best solution is to carefully trim the base of the trunk to fit the stand’s opening. Use a saw (a handsaw or chainsaw will work) to shave off small sections of the wood evenly around the circumference of the trunk until it fits snugly into the stand. Avoid removing too much wood at once, and continually check the fit to ensure it’s not too loose. Remember to prioritize safety and wear appropriate protective gear like gloves and eye protection.

Are there different types of Christmas tree stands, and which is best?

Yes, several types of Christmas tree stands are available, each with its own pros and cons. The most common are the screw-in type, which uses screws to tighten around the trunk; the center pin type, which relies on a single spike in the center of the stand; and the clamping type, which uses a lever system to secure the tree. Screw-in stands are generally the most versatile and reliable, accommodating a wider range of tree sizes and shapes.

The “best” type depends on your individual needs and preferences. Consider the size and weight of your tree, your budget, and how easy the stand is to set up and use. Some stands offer features like built-in water level indicators and wider bases for increased stability. Researching different models and reading reviews can help you choose a stand that best suits your specific situation and provides a secure and hassle-free setup.

How can I add extra stability to my Christmas tree stand?

Even with the correct size stand, you might want to add extra stability, especially for taller or heavier trees. One simple method is to place weights around the base of the stand. Sandbags, bricks wrapped in fabric, or even decorative rocks can provide additional ballast and prevent the tree from tipping. Ensure the weights are evenly distributed around the stand for optimal effectiveness.

Another option is to use guy wires or ropes to secure the tree to nearby walls or furniture. Attach the wires to the tree’s trunk or branches at a few points and then anchor them to secure points in the room. This method is particularly useful for trees placed in high-traffic areas or homes with children or pets. Remember to conceal the wires as much as possible for a more aesthetically pleasing look.

How do I know if my Christmas tree stand is faulty and needs replacing?

Several signs indicate that your Christmas tree stand might be faulty and needs replacement. If the tightening screws are stripped or broken, preventing them from properly gripping the tree trunk, it’s a clear indication that the stand is compromised. Similarly, if the stand’s base is cracked or damaged, it may not be able to support the tree’s weight, posing a safety risk.

Also, if the stand consistently fails to keep the tree upright despite your best efforts, or if it wobbles excessively even when properly set up, it’s time to consider a replacement. Ignoring these warning signs could lead to a tree falling over, potentially causing damage or injury. It’s better to invest in a new, reliable stand than to risk an accident during the holidays. Prioritize safety and replace a faulty stand immediately.
